Session 1: Player Orientation. I get to know the player. What is their interest level in soccer? What are their goals for their development? What is their mental, physical, technical, and tactical capacity? What position do they play? What areas do they desire to improve in?
Session 2: Player Development. I put together a macro session plan for my time with the player. I use a periodized approach. This means that we take things one session at a time. I won't move on to the next development level until I know that a player has mastered a skill. I engage the player to determine their perception on their development. I give the player "homework" in order to work on skills outside of our time together. I believe that true development comes from a player's commitment outside of personal training. A player will not see significant improvement just by training with me once a week. A player will see improvement if they repeat our training over and over and over again.
Session 3 and beyond: Continued Player Development. My aim is for the player to take ownership over their training. My job as a coach is to provide the player with resources and feedback. Players who want to play at the next level will receive my feedback and then apply it on their own and at their team training sessions. They will watch soccer to improve tactically. They will have a ball at their foot outside of training to improve technically. They will run sprints in their backyard to improve physically. They will put themselves in situations that are difficult to improve mentally. My job is to fan these desires into flame.
